what is the microbiome?
Your Microbiome is the vast ecosystem of organisms (microbiota) such as bacteria, yeasts and fungi that live within the gut. Collectively, the 100 trillion gut microbiota in your gut are heavier than the average brain, and are vital in regulating your immune system, digesting food, metabolism, producing vitamins and even maintaining mental wellbeing.
The gut is known as your body’s second brain, and the Gut-Brain Axis goes some way in explaining this. Look after it, and it will look after you!
